Subject: [PATCH] xfs: only SetPageUptodate if all buffers are uptodate

xfs_vm_writepage and xfs_page_convert set a page uptodate if it is determined
that all of the buffer_heads attached to that page are uptodate.

Currently we use the flag variable 'uptodate'.  The flag is initially set = 1
and it is cleared if a !buffer_uptodate buffer is encountered.  In addition we
check that bh == head in order to ensure that all of the buffer_heads have been
checked.  However, it is possible to break out of the buffer_head loop early
having processed only the first buffer.  This leaves uptodate == 1 and bh ==
head, so the uptodate bit can be set on a page even if not all of the buffers
have been checked.  This can lead to data corruption on platforms with > 1
buffer per page.

 f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_aops.c |   16 ++++++++--------
 1 files changed, 8 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_aops.c b/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_aops.c
index 52dbd14..c961f35 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_aops.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_aops.c
@@ -686,7 +686,7 @@ xfs_convert_page(
 	unsigned long		p_offset;
 	unsigned int		type;
 	int			len, page_dirty;
-	int			count = 0, done = 0, uptodate = 1;
+	int			count = 0, done = 0, uptodate = 0;
  	xfs_off_t		offset = page_offset(page);
 
 	if (page->index != tindex)
@@ -727,8 +727,8 @@ xfs_convert_page(
 	do {
 		if (offset >= end_offset)
 			break;
-		if (!buffer_uptodate(bh))
-			uptodate = 0;
+		if (buffer_uptodate(bh))
+			uptodate++;
 		if (!(PageUptodate(page) || buffer_uptodate(bh))) {
 			done = 1;
 			continue;
@@ -761,7 +761,7 @@ xfs_convert_page(
 		}
 	} while (offset += len, (bh = bh->b_this_page) != head);
 
-	if (uptodate && bh == head)
+	if (uptodate == (PAGE_CACHE_SIZE / len))
 		SetPageUptodate(page);
 
 	if (count) {
@@ -915,7 +915,7 @@ xfs_vm_writepage(
 	__uint64_t              end_offset;
 	pgoff_t                 end_index, last_index;
 	ssize_t			len;
-	int			err, imap_valid = 0, uptodate = 1;
+	int			err, imap_valid = 0, uptodate = 0;
 	int			count = 0;
 	int			nonblocking = 0;
 
@@ -978,8 +978,8 @@ xfs_vm_writepage(
 
 		if (offset >= end_offset)
 			break;
-		if (!buffer_uptodate(bh))
-			uptodate = 0;
+		if (buffer_uptodate(bh))
+			uptodate++;
 
 		/*
 		 * set_page_dirty dirties all buffers in a page, independent
@@ -1047,7 +1047,7 @@ xfs_vm_writepage(
 
 	} while (offset += len, ((bh = bh->b_this_page) != head));
 
-	if (uptodate && bh == head)
+	if (uptodate == (PAGE_CACHE_SIZE / len))
 		SetPageUptodate(page);
 
 	xfs_start_page_writeback(page, 1, count);
